Hebrew word study

פֹּעַלpôʻal an act or work (concretely)

Pronounced “po'-al

an act or work (concretely)

Translated in the King James as: act, deed, do, getting, maker, work.

Appears 37 times in Scripture

Origin: from H6466 (פָּעַל);
